Default Solar shades

We had them come out and gives an estimate for our screened in lanai. We found them to be reasonable enough but it just so happened that Home Depot was having a 20% discount on all custom orders and the Coolaroo brand ended up being a lot cheaper...$153 a shade compared with $249 a shade and we needed four of them. Coolaro has a three year warranty which we thought was better as well. The only down side with Home Depot is that we will install them ourselves as opposed to other company installing them. Home Depot wanted an additional $118 to install.
